No answer from insurance yet. I called them just now and they stated that my Dr.'s office left some info off of the paperwork. It's all small stuff like is it inpatient/outpatient, provider info, place of service, tax id ect. Once they get that info back from my Dr.'s office it'll take another 5 business days to hear back.
